1201  Economy / Trading Discussion / Re: Margin Trading Exchanges? on: February 08, 2015, 01:08:00 AM
I love Okcoin futures.  It's the best one I've found.  The iOS app makes trading so simple ( I use it exclusively )

20:1 is crazy but I have a good method/strategy

Care to explain? Tongue

The fee sounds high like on bitfinex. I found that its hard on bitfinex because you have to fight the fee first until you get into the positives. So you always have a disadvantage. I hoped its better on other exchanges with lower fees.

How do you handle stop losses? Avoiding flash trading and finding real wrong decisions is a not so easy part i think.

I think this thread should be moved to trading discussion.

I dontt use stop losses,  they are good at fishing them out and triggering them.  With 20:1 futures your fee is already paid when you purchase the contract so that's it, (margin positions are different). Shitty thing is with 20:1 your liquidation price is a $10 swing.  With that being said I always build my positions slow at diff price points, continuously adding.  

So your risk strategy is "betting" a small amount only each time? Which percent of your total amount of available money you set?

What does the fee is paid already mean? The 0.2% is paid one time only for the leveraged amount of money? Looks like i have to change okcoin then to CFD right?

I build my positions slowly to prevent a margin call.  I never go all in with 2 orders, that is what I have learned in the past from mistakes.  I usually fill orders 10-15% at a time,  but there are exceptions such as that failed dump that happeneds this past Wednesday which I knew it wouldn't go much lower, so I grabbed 400 contracts at 213 and had another order of 200 @ 204 (I knew there was no way it would go lower judging by the volume and no panic) so the risk was worth it.

I just checked log history and it's about 396 santoshi to open up a contract of 3

I usually have about 4-5 orders filled before the market swings and I take profit.  I'm ok with a 30-40% profit

Coinbase pump was epic for me,  rode it from 223 up to 294  Grin


Did you know about coinbase pump before? I have read that its important to check the news, mainly coming from china. Only thing is that i dont find a reliable place, where i could find the news that could change prices, early enough.

are you referring to the exchanges like bitstamp?

In general yes, though its a special case because its possible here to earn money when trading against a rising bitcoin price or against a falling bitcoin price. On top you can bet more money than you have. That means higher risk but possible higher return too. I would not suggest trading it before you really learned without risking money since its risky.
